Temuco-Maquehue vs Guwahati Climate & Distance Between

India flag
  • The distance between Temuco-Maquehue, Chile and Guwahati, India is approximately 17,977 km or 11,171 mi.
  • To reach Temuco-Maquehue in this distance one would set out from Guwahati bearing 222.4°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Temuco-Maquehue bearing 309.1° or NW .
  • Temuco-Maquehue has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Guwahati has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Temuco-Maquehue is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Guwahati is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 13 °C (23.4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.1 °C (5.6°F) less in Temuco-Maquehue.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 564.6 mm (22.2 in) less which is equivalent to 564.6 l/m² (13.86 US gal/ft²) or 5,646,000 l/ha (603,595 US gal/ac) less. About 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 13.4° lower in Temuco-Maquehue than in Guwahati.
  • Relative humidity levels are 5.3%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 11.6°C (20.9°F) lower.
